NiNi Harris is one of Cornerstone Travel Group founders and her passion of writing and history showcases in her books, publications and tours. Born and raised in the Gateway City and residing in St. Louis' Dutchtown neighborhood all of her life, NiNi's love for her city runs deep and personal. She has written over 18 comprehensive books on St. Louis' great architecture, cultures, neighborhoods and history. She has been called "St. Louis' greatest modern-day historian" as much of her time is spent sorting through crumbling records and documenting the history of our amazing City. Her works have explored the stories of immigrants coming to St. Louis and establishing the incredible patchwork of distinct cultural districts, many still intact and vibrant today. One of her most popular books, now in second edition, is "Downtown St. Louis" capturing the remarkable, alluring and ever-changing center of the city. Recently, NiNi would dig deeper into St. Louis' diverse African American history with her release of her book "Black St. Louis".
This Autumn, NiNi celebrates her latest book "St. Louis Hills: A Walk through History" capturing the South City neighborhoods history from religion to cultural diversity. NiNi also writes about St. Louis Hills as one of the greatest architectural neighborhoods of the city "noting the Germanic building traditions and the art deco styling of the early 20th century."
